Twenty Something is a raw, honest community for people in their twenties (or anyone who still feels like they are). Here we overshare, laugh at our own chaos, and unpack what’s called the ‘defining decade’—all in an effort to set ourselves up for the future and build the lives we actually want. Frequently Asked Questions About Twenty Something

What is Twenty Something about and what kind of topics does it cover?

The show centers on practical life navigation for people in their twenties, blending candid personal stories with actionable advice. Episodes span topics like faith and doubt, health and fitness, career pivots, grief and healing, and mindset shifts for building meaningful relationships and sustainable habits. A notable strength is its approachable, empathetic tone that blends real-world coaching with vulnerability, making complex transitions feel doable. Guests range from health-tech founders and fitness entrepreneurs to survivors and faith leaders, often sharing concrete strategies, mindset tools, and inspiring reinvention journeys that listeners can imitate in their own lives.
